Now on display at the National Museum of Naval Aviation this Coronado is the last survivor of 210 built and was intended as a larger, higher perfomance variant of the Catalina. This aircraft served as an executive transport taking the staff of Fleet Admiral Chester W. Nimitz to Tokyo for the Japanese surrender ceremony on 2nd September 1945.

This A-4 served previously with VF-45 at NAS Key West, FL before being retired to AMARG in Feb. 94 and stored with the PCN/Inventory No. AN3A0739. It was lucky enough to leave the boneyard in Jul. 01 for restoration and now resides in the yard of the Planes of Fame Museum at Chino.

This floatplane version of the N3N-3 trainer was given the nickname of 'Yellow Peril' by the trainee Naval pilots. This particular airfame (the BuNo is not original to it) has the distinction of being the first aircraft to be accepted into the National Naval Aviation Museum's permanent collection. Actual serial is 1759.

The TA-4J was the trainer version of the A-4F and this VC-8 'Aggressor' aircraft was one of the last active Skyhawks in service. Her last flight was April 2003, flying from NAS Roosevelt Roads, PR into retirement at the March Field Air Museum.

Coded 18 with USN unit VQ-2 this reconaissance Skywarrior was arriving on a weekday before the 76 Air Tattoo. Ed Heinemann's brilliance and weight control discipline got the US Navy a carrier based strategic nuclear bomber. Pan Am looked into leasing a couple around 1957 to give their crews transonic operating experience before the 707 arrived,but nothing came of it.

Sitting here in the Western International yard, this C-118 went on to a civil career but crashed into the sea off Curacao on 18 September 1992. At that time it was operating as YV-502C with Aero Ejecutivos SA.
